The John Bell House, nestled on Dover's historic Green, offers a captivating glimpse into 18th-century life in Delaware's capital. This unassuming clapboard structure, dating back to the mid-1700s, served various roles, from a workshop to a post office, witnessing pivotal moments in the First State's history.

Getting There
-
Walking
If you're already in downtown Dover, the John Bell House is easily accessible on foot. Head towards The Green, a central park area. The John Bell House is located at 43 The Green. Look for signs directing you to First State Heritage Park. The area is pedestrian-friendly, with sidewalks and crosswalks.
-
Public Transport
For those using public transportation, the DART First State bus service offers routes that connect to Dover. You can take the bus to the Dover Transit Center, located at 79 W Loockerman St. From the transit center, it is a short 5-minute walk to First State Heritage Park. Head east on W Loockerman St, then turn right onto The Green. The park is at 43 The Green. Check the DART First State website for current bus schedules and fares. A single ride fare is typically $2.00.
-
Car
If you're driving, head towards The Green in Dover, DE. From the central Dover area, take N State St. heading north, then turn left onto W Loockerman St. Continue straight until you reach The Green. First State Heritage Park is located at 43 The Green, Dover, DE 19901. Parking is available along the street and in nearby lots, but be aware of any parking signs for potential fees. Free parking is available at the First State Heritage Park Welcome Center.
